Types of Printing Services

When selecting the perfect printing services in Australia for your business needs, it’s important to comprehend the different types of printing services available. These include Offset Lithographic Printing, Digital Printing, and Large Format Printing.

Offset Lithographic Printing

Offset lithographic printing, commonly referred to as offset printing, is a traditional method of printing that is ideal for large volume projects. It works by transferring an inked image from a plate to a rubber blanket, and then onto the printing surface.

The advantages of offset printing include high-quality, consistent image output, and cost-effectiveness for large print runs. It is particularly useful for projects such as brochure printing, catalogue printing, and flyer printing. However, the initial set-up costs can be higher, making it less suitable for smaller print runs.

Digital Printing

Digital printing is a modern printing technique that works by transferring a digital image directly onto the print medium. This type of printing is fast, flexible, and perfect for short print runs with a quick turnaround time.

Digital printing is ideal for customised printing requirements, as it allows for easy modification of images and text. It is often used for business card printing, label printing, and notepad printing. While per-unit costs can be higher than offset printing, there are no initial set-up costs, making it cost-effective for small jobs.

Large Format Printing

As the name suggests, large format printing is designed for larger print sizes. This type of printing is commonly used when creating large-scale signage, banners, and posters. Large format printing can produce items such as banner printing, poster printing, and signage printing.

Large format printing offers high-quality, durable prints that are resistant to fading. While the printing process can be slower, and the cost higher than other methods, the impact of large, visually striking prints can be a significant benefit for businesses.

Understanding Print Proofing

Print proofing is a critical step in the printing process. It’s an opportunity to review and approve the final design before it goes to print. Understanding how to proof your materials can save you time and money by preventing errors or unsatisfactory results.

Most printing services will provide a digital proof, which is an on-screen preview of how your printed material will look. However, keep in mind that colours may vary between different screens and actual print. If colour accuracy is crucial for your project, ask for a hard-copy proof.

Remember, once you’ve approved the proofs, any mistakes discovered later will typically be your responsibility. So take the time to review all text, graphics, colours, and layout in the proofing stage.

Planning Your Printing Needs in Advance

Planning is a crucial part of working with printing services. By understanding your printing needs before you approach a printer, you’ll be able to provide clear instructions, which can help avoid misunderstandings and ensure that the final product meets your expectations.

Next, consider the quantity you need. This can affect the printing technique used. For example, offset printing is more cost-effective for large quantities, while digital printing is better for smaller runs.

Finally, consider your timeline. If you need your materials quickly, digital printing might be the better option as it has a quicker turnaround time. However, if you have more time and require a larger quantity, offset printing could be more suitable.
